application.yml
spring:
elasticsearch:
jest:
uris: http://192.168.47.133:9200 # linux服务器地址
data:
elasticsearch:
cluster-name: my-application
cluster-nodes: 192.168.47.133:9300
Bean
@NoArgsConstructor
@AllArgsConstructor
@Data
public class Article {
@JestId
private Integer id;
private String author;
private String title;
private String content;
}
@AllArgsConstructor
@NoArgsConstructor
@Data
@Document(indexName = "test",type = "book")
public class Book {
private Integer id;
private String bookName;
private String author;
}
Repository
public interface BookRep extends ElasticsearchRepository<Book,Integer> {
public List<Book> findByBookNameLike(String bookName);
}
Test
@SpringBootTest
class Springboot03ElasticsearchApplicationTests {
@Autowired
JestClient jestClient;
@Test
void contextLoads() {
//给es索引中创建一个文档
Article article = new Article();
article.setId(1);
article.setTitle("好消息");
article.setAuthor("张三");
article.setContent("hello world");
// 构建一个索引功能
Index index = new Index.Builder(article).index("test").type("news").build();
try {
jestClient.execute(index);
} catch (IOException e) {
e.printStackTrace();
}
}
@Test
public void search() {
String json = " \"query\":{ \"term\":{ \"content\":hello } }";
Search search = new Search.Builder(json).addIndex("test").addType("news").build();
try {
SearchResult result = jestClient.execute(search);
System.out.println(result.getJsonString());
} catch (IOException e) {
e.printStackTrace();
}
}
@Autowired
BookRep bookRep;
@Test
public void repositoryTest(){
Book book = new Book(1,"三国","罗贯中");
bookRep.index(book);
}
@Test
public void repositoryTest2(){
//Book book = new Book(1,"三国","罗贯中");
List<Book> books = bookRep.findByBookNameLike("三");
System.out.println(books);
}
}
/**
* springboot默认支持两种技术和ES交互
* 1.Jest(默认不生效),需要导入Jest的工具包
* 2.SpringData ElasticSearch:(es版本有可能不合适)
* Client节点信息
* ElasticSearchTemplate操作es
* 编写ElasticSearchRepository的子接口来操作es:
* interface BookRep extends ElasticsearchRepository<Book,Integer(主键类型)>
*/
